Resumo: |
Many studies focused on the teaching of science are currently debating the use of new methodological approaches in teaching processes, among which we can highlight the elaboration and application of Teaching-Learning Sequences (TLS) based on the Integrated Constructivist Perspective (Méheut). This is a European methodological current that aims to present a short curriculum to address certain scientific knowledge in the classroom. This proposal suggests substantial changes in the way in which teaching is taking place in schools, which demands the teachers' need to know and adopt new methodologies. However, the insertion of these trends depends on how the teacher understands and appropriates them. Aware of the difficulties faced in the processes of initial teacher training in Brazil, we propose to develop in this thesis a formative proposal based on the construction of new meanings for the teaching-learning process. For that, an instructional process was developed through the articulation between theoretical and practical elements based on Artigue's Didactic Engineering Approach (ED), where we contemplate from the theoretical perspective the experimentation of the educational practice. The organizational dynamics used for this training process was based on three stages: Theoretical Formation; Structuring / Designing a TLS and Design Review, after the formative stage, the implementation and validation of the built sequence occurred. In view of this context, our objective was to understand the contributions of a formative process developed with seniors, based on didactic engineering premises, which involves the design, application and validation of a teaching-learning sequence. The research was developed within the scope of initial education with a pair of graduates of the Physics Course - IFPE PIBID. The study is of a qualitative nature, with emphasis on action research, being used as data collection instruments observations, videography and semi-structured interviews. The results showed that the training proposal points to the importance of the articulation between theoretical and practical elements in the training process, considering that evidence was found of the difficulties faced by the seniors during the TLS design process (practical stage), which leads us To question the efficiency of learning by essentially theoretical approaches. The results also show the potential of the theoretical-methodological framework of the Integrated Constructivist Perspective for the TLS design process as it presents characteristics quite different from traditional teaching approaches. In addition, the study reveals the importance of effective follow-up of teacher trainers in all phases of the training process, and especially in the sequence structuring phase. The study also showed that didactic engineering provided important subsidies for the analysis of the training process because it allowed the understanding of the impacts caused by the teaching practices developed during the application of the teaching-learning sequence applied to high school students. |
